Hurricane Local Statement
TROPICAL STORM ERNESTO LOCAL STATEMENT
AMZ130-135-150-152-154-156-158-NCZ029-044>047-079>081-090>095-098-103
-104-312130-

TROPICAL STORM ERNESTO LOCAL STATEMENT
NATIONAL WEATHER SERVICE NEWPORT/MOREHEAD CITY NC
325 PM EDT THU AUG 31 2006

...TROPICAL STORM WARNING IN EFFECT FROM CURRITUCK BEACH LIGHT
SOUTH...
...HURRICANE WATCH IN EFFECT FOR CAPE LOOKOUT SOUTH...

...NEW INFORMATION...
NEW EVACUATION AND SHELTER INFORMATION FOR BEAUFORT COUNTY.
RECOMMENDATIONS FROM HYDE COUNTY. STORM INFORMATION HAS BEEN
UPDATED.

FOR BEAUFORT COUNTY...A MANDATORY EVACUATION HAS BEEN ORDERED FOR
WHICHARDS BEACH ROAD AND LOW LYING AREAS IN BEAUFORT COUNTY
INCLUDING FLOOD PRONE AREAS IN THE CITY WASHINGTON. ONE SHELTER WILL
BE OPEN IN WASHINGTON AT NEW PS JONES MIDDLE SCHOOL AT 4105 NORTH
MARKET STREET EXTENSION.

FOR HYDE COUNTY...THE OCRACOKE CONTROL GROUP IS RECOMMENDING
SHELTERING IN PLACE. HOWEVER...ANY PERSON WITH SERIOUS MEDICAL
CONDITION SHOULD CONSIDER LEAVING THE ISLAND.

...AREAS AFFECTED...
THIS STATEMENT IS FOR RESIDENTS OF THE FOLLOWING COUNTIES IN
EASTERN NORTH CAROLINA...

ONSLOW...CARTERET...HYDE...DARE...CRAVEN...BEAUFORT...TYRRELL...
WASHINGTON...PAMLICO...MARTIN...PITT...LENOIR...GREENE...JONES...AND
DUPLIN.

...WATCHES/WARNINGS...
A TROPICAL STORM WARNING IS IN EFFECT FOR SOUTH OF CURRITUCK BEACH
LIGHT. A HURRICANE WATCH IS IN EFFECT FOR CAPE LOOKOUT SOUTH.
A TROPICAL STORM WARNING MEANS TROPICAL STORM CONDITIONS ARE
EXPECTED WITHIN 24 HOURS. A HURRICANE WATCH MEANS THAT HURRICANE
CONDITIONS ARE POSSIBLE IN THE WATCH AREA IN THE NEXT 24 HOURS.

...STORM INFORMATION...
AT 200 PM EDT THE CENTER OF TROPICAL STORM ERNESTO WAS LOCATED NEAR
LATITUDE 31.9 NORTH...LONGITUDE 79.1 WEST...OR ABOUT 180 MILES
SOUTH-SOUTHWEST OF WILMINGTON NORTH CAROLINA.

ERNESTO IS MOVING TOWARD THE NORTH-NORTHEAST NEAR 17 MPH. ON THIS
TRACK THE CENTER OF ERNESTO WILL BE NEAR THE COAST OF THE CAROLINAS
LATER THIS EVENING.

DATA FROM A AIRCRAFT INDICATE THAT MAXIMUM SUSTAINED WINDS HAVE
INCREASED TO NEAR 70 MPH...WITH HIGHER GUSTS. ERNESTO COULD
STRENGTHEN A LITTLE MORE AND REACH THE COAST AS A MINIMAL HURRICANE.

...P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...
CLOSELY MONITOR THE FORECAST FOR ERNESTO. PEOPLE ARE URGED TO
PREPARE FOR THE STORM. THOSE IN LOW LYING AND FLOOD PRONE AREAS
SHOULD CONSIDER MOVING TO HIGHER GROUND AS ERNESTO MOVES THROUGH.

MONITOR NOAA ALL HAZARDS WEATHER RADIO OR LOCAL TV AND RADIO IN CASE
FLASH FLOOD OR TORNADO WARNINGS ARE ISSUED.

ALL PREPAREDNESS ACTIVITIES SHOULD BE RUSHED TO COMPLETION.

...STORM SURGE FLOOD AND STORM TIDE IMPACTS...
IN GENERAL A 3 TO 5 FOOT STORM SURGE IS EXPECTED. THE HIGHEST
STORM SURGE WILL BE AROUND 1 AM EARLY FRIDAY MORNING...NEAR THE
NORMAL TIME OF HIGH TIDE. STORM SURGES OF 4 TO 5 FEET ARE POSSIBLE
IN THE NEUSE AND PAMLICO RIVERS AS FAR INLAND AS NEW BERN AND
WASHINGTON. IN ONSLOW COUNTY A STORM SURGE OF 5 FEET IS EXPECTED ON
TOPSAIL ISLAND. OTHER AREAS THAT COULD SEE WATER LEVELS 4 FEET
ABOVE NORMAL INCLUDE THE PORTION OF DOWNEAST CARTERET COUNTY THAT IS
ADJACENT TO THE NEUSE RIVER AND EXTREME EASTERN PAMLICO COUNTY.

...WIND IMPACTS...
WINDS WILL BEGIN TO INCREASE LATE THIS AFTERNOON AHEAD OF ERNESTO.
WIND SPEEDS WILL INCREASE TO 30 TO 40 MPH WITH GUSTS TO 50 MPH
TONIGHT INTO FRIDAY MORNING. THIS INCLUDES INLAND COUNTIES ALONG AND
EAST OF THE PATH OF ERNESTO...WHERE INLAND TROPICAL STORM WARNINGS
HAVE BEEN ISSUED.

...FLOODING IMPACTS...
FOUR TO SEVEN INCHES OF RAIN IS LIKELY ACROSS EASTERN NORTH CAROLINA
THROUGH FRIDAY MORNING. LOCALLY HEAVIER AMOUNTS WILL BE POSSIBLE.
THE HEAVIEST RAIN WILL OCCUR TONIGHT AND EARLY FRIDAY MORNING. A
FLASH FLOOD WATCH IS IN EFFECT FOR ALL OF EASTERN NORTH CAROLINA
THROUGH FRIDAY MORNING.

...TORNADO IMPACTS...
ISOLATED TORNADOES WILL BE POSSIBLE THROUGH FRIDAY MORNING.

...RIP CURRENT IMPACTS...
THE RISK OF RIP CURRENTS WILL BE HIGH THROUGH FRIDAY. PEOPLE ARE
URGED TO STAY OUT OF THE WATER UNTIL ERNESTO HAS MOVED OUT OF THE
AREA...AND THE SEAS HAVE RETURNED TO A SAFE LEVEL.

...HIGH SURF/BEACH EROSION IMPACTS...
SEAS WILL BUILD TO 7 TO 10 FEET THIS EVENING...AND 10 TO 14
FEET AFTER MIDNIGHT ALONG THE SOUTH FACING BEACHES...THEN CONTINUE
FOR THE ENTIRE COAST ON FRIDAY. THIS WILL RESULT IN ROUGH SURF AND
MINOR TO MODERATE BEACH EROSION TONIGHT INTO FRIDAY.
